PA GOP: Keep More Money in Pennsylvanians’ Wallets

Governor Corbett continues to fight for lower taxes and responsible spending.

 
HARRISBURG – Republican Party of Pennsylvania Chairman Rob Gleason issued the following statement reiterating support for Governor Tom Corbett’s proposed 2011-2012 budget that confronts government spending while holding the line on taxes:

“Governor Tom Corbett’s 2011-2012 fiscally responsible budget proposal puts Pennsylvania back on the right track by curbing wasteful government spending while not raising our taxes by a single cent. In spite of a $4 billion budget gap, this was a huge victory for Pennsylvania taxpayers, empowering families to keep more of their hard earned money in their wallets as they work through a difficult economy,” Chairman Rob Gleason said.

“Last year Pennsylvanians demanded fiscal responsibility and that is exactly what Governor Corbett is delivering. Pennsylvania has a spending problem, not a revenue problem, and it’s unfortunate that some would push across the board tax increases than make the difficult but necessary budget decisions to ensure Pennsylvania is living within its means. The sad reality is that countless, hardworking Pennsylvania families have been forced to make tough decisions on their own because Governor Rendell and his Democrat colleagues failed to do so. The bottom line is that we all need to support commonsense solutions that include living within our means to reverse the spending explosion that marked years of Democrat fiscal mismanagement.  Governor Corbett is leading that charge and we stand squarely behind him.”
